Output 38c12e54f00a514cdce3df19e6b4dddf21e8ac212462f591016980fda4ceb8ed:1

value
5708156
script pubkey
OP_0 OP_PUSHBYTES_20 1013e08737b4e2824d4bc56945c3e3090d60f4e3
address
bc1qzqf7ppehkn3gyn2tc455tslrpyxkpa8r56zv8a
transaction
38c12e54f00a514cdce3df19e6b4dddf21e8ac212462f591016980fda4ceb8ed
confirmations
15284
spent
true